Bands entering jacksonville. Frances finally pays her visit

#1 Postby FlSteel » Sun Sep 05, 2004 6:40 am

Winds and rain now into Jacksonville. Just had a band go through my place in southern Jax. Power is flickering on and off, and the rain is coming down in sheets. Some high gusts and small branches are littering the yard from the oaks. The pine trees in the neighborhood are dancing, swaying back and forth. Hopefully this is what it will be like for the duration. We have had several tornadoes spotted this morning on doppler radar south of here in St. Johns county and Clay county. Hope everyone keeps safe and keep indoors. My prayer goes out to all those people still in this across the state.
